Development and reliability and validity testing of the Good Death Scale for terminally ill patients

Abstract: Objective: To develop a Good Death Scale for terminal patients and test its reliability and validity. Methods: Guided by the good death model, an initial version of the scale was developed through literature review, semi-structured interview and expert correspondence and pilot survey. From January to March 2023, patients were selected from the outpatients and wards in two tertiary grade A hospitals in Beijing and Tianjin for questionnaire survey, and the item analysis and reliability and validity testing were carried out for the scale. Results: Good Death Scale was composed of 6 dimensions with a total of 29 items. The content validity index (CVI) of the scale was 0.979, and the CVI of each item (I-CVI) was between 0.800 and 1.000. The Cronbach' α coefficient of the scale is 0.877, and the half reliability coefficient is 0.803. Conclusion: The Good Death Scale for terminally ill patients is with good reliability and validity, and it can be used as a tool to measure the death quality for terminal patients in China.
